Atom serves as the native cryptocurrency of the Cosmos network, playing a crucial role in securing the network through staking and participating in governance decisions. As more users join the Cosmos ecosystem and interact with various decentralized applications (dApps) built on the network, the demand for Atom tokens increases. This growing demand coupled with a limited supply could potentially drive up the value of Atom over time.
One of the primary reasons behind the increased accumulation of Atom tokens is the ongoing development and adoption of the Cosmos network. Developers continue to build new applications and services on Cosmos, leveraging its unique features like the Inter-Blockchain Communication (IBC) protocol to enable seamless communication between different blockchains. This expanding ecosystem not only enhances the utility of Atom but also creates new opportunities for investors to participate in the growth of the network.
